Antonio Galloni (AG) — 94/100 · Vinous, 28/01/2025 · Drink 2026-2030
The 2022 Montlandrie is another stellar wine in this range from the Durantou sisters. A healthy percentage of Cabernets (30%) in the blend adds aromatic lift and gorgeous supporting structure. Montlandrie is a complete wine. It offers striking aromatics, layered, sepia-toned fruit and exquisite balance, along with a beautifully articulate, sustained finish that is quite simply captivating. William Kelley (WK) — 90–92/100 · Wine Advocate, RobertParker.com, 15/06/2023
Notes of sweet cherries, berries, licorice and smoke preface the 2022 Montlandrie, a medium to full-bodied, suave and vibrant wine with a deep core of fruit, lively acids, powdery tannins and a saline finish. This vibrant, intensely flavored Cotes de Castillon is once again one of Bordeaux's best values in this vintage.
Neal Martin (NM) — 92/100 · Vinous, 12/02/2025 · Drink 2029-2043
The 2022 Montlandrie, which came across more like a Left Bank wine out of barrel, veers back toward Cotes de Castillon now that it is in bottle. This is quite opulent yet deftly controlled on the nose, with copious black fruit, vanilla extract, violet and dark chocolate aromas.
